Q: Why is the order cutoff Wednesday morning for Friday Deliveries?
A: We use no commercial yeast in our bread. Using wild yeast (or sourdough starter) requires a longer time for the dough to proof and rise and be ready to bake. Our sourdough bread process takes 48 hours.

Q: How long will the fresh baked good last?
A: We think you and your near and dear will love them so much there will never be any issue with freshness :) However, if they are not eaten within a day or so, please pack in an airtight container where they will stay fresh in the refrigerator for a week or in the freezer for a couple of months. Bring them to room temperature and you can microwave for a few seconds to refresh and recreate that fresh baked taste!
We recommend the sourdough breads be sliced when completely cool and packed in a freezer safe bag or container and frozen. Take out slices as you like and toast to recreate the just baked freshness.
